It’s the Season 3 premiere of the 30 Pause Podcast and I couldn’t be happier! It’s been quite the adventure in my off time between seasons & I’m letting you in on the deets with where I’m at as a 36-year-old woman navigating through 30 Pause, doing the work, riding the rollercoaster of emotions & continuing to grow. I introduce the most prominent subject areas of 30 Pause and how each episode will be centered around it. First up: Relationships & Friendships. It’s honest, it’s raw, and it’s relatable. I give you the deets of each category/phase, how that’s going to play out, benefit us all and what to expect in the upcoming episodes. I also share the continuous tale of my dreadful neighbor and how our relationship is never going to be copasetic. I'm also touching on a book that’s really changed my mindset with my own creativity in the “What’s Really Good” segment.
